From patchwork Wed Sep 9 04:32:46 2015 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Simon Glass X-Patchwork-Id: 515693 X-Patchwork-Delegate: sjg@chromium.org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Received: from theia.denx.de (theia.denx.de [85.214.87.163]) by ozlabs.org (Postfix) with ESMTP id 2AF33140497 for ; Wed, 9 Sep 2015 14:42:38 +1000 (AEST) Authentication-Results: ozlabs.org; dkim=fail reason="signature verification failed" (2048-bit key; unprotected) header.d=google.com header.i=@google.com header.b=UipWIaQ8; dkim-atps=neutral Received: from localhost (localhost [127.0.0.1]) by theia.denx.de (Postfix) with ESMTP id 8A2F24B83A; Wed, 9 Sep 2015 06:42:35 +0200 (CEST) Received: from theia.denx.de ([127.0.0.1]) by localhost (theia.denx.de [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id DI4qBLhhZ0Lw; Wed, 9 Sep 2015 06:42:35 +0200 (CEST) Received: from theia.denx.de (localhost [127.0.0.1]) by theia.denx.de (Postfix) with ESMTP id 9AE324B7F5; Wed, 9 Sep 2015 06:42:25 +0200 (CEST) Received: from localhost (localhost [127.0.0.1]) by theia.denx.de (Postfix) with ESMTP id DE9DC4B796 for ; Wed, 9 Sep 2015 06:42:16 +0200 (CEST) Received: from theia.denx.de ([127.0.0.1]) by localhost (theia.denx.de [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id nGRmTjwtrJCS for ; Wed, 9 Sep 2015 06:42:16 +0200 (CEST) X-policyd-weight: NOT_IN_SBL_XBL_SPAMHAUS=-1.5 NOT_IN_SPAMCOP=-1.5 NOT_IN_BL_NJABL=-1.5 (only DNSBL check requested) Received: from mail-io0-f175.google.com (mail-io0-f175.google.com [209.85.223.175]) by theia.denx.de (Postfix) with ESMTPS id 7ED584B71C for ; Wed, 9 Sep 2015 06:42:13 +0200 (CEST) Received: by ioii196 with SMTP id i196so9079034ioi.3 for ; Tue, 08 Sep 2015 21:42:12 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20120113; h=sender:from:to:cc:subject:date:message-id:in-reply-to:references; bh=WnI6+w3wX0kvRMC4dqyDMtJmvGuB74o4S5hlN2IWM+U=; b=UipWIaQ8DWsZP46bGx/ECtXQQ8LrjiyZQONzSRNRgPzvUakcrk5622emz8FiniTNMB GIlreQxlvNiP5bCa56rPdIypMVYvdMIfZ69Rj+OZkkLfzcBvCH4MZdaC7tkXQeFo8uFD CUZIY4YGSvUwZWLEqRP9ba7/kt29yFaqCBfQiOx+4keaoeBlFHVSakhgGLlPc6fv8Z04 +iUrMw2ayuD6mZT/us8bjVuRUXW7nGyR2vRG6whCp01VIYV89yTNrdXGGWONKxFR+aNg PPU6rOw890bKXNRYpUzG7ohLlN73+aEuARXADlynL6+J6db+cDea7j/oJnIe0906YDxE +jVQ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:sender:from:to:cc:subject:date:message-id :in-reply-to:references; bh=WnI6+w3wX0kvRMC4dqyDMtJmvGuB74o4S5hlN2IWM+U=; b=dceg8kGqkFmG/9AKGUsxIt2Kt+l2aBTmTUm/9ijgUTDeVpBUC0jpoCpl6KVQZ72eF3 fNYHbxXaeaBG36kfj/UB13yQq18KhEUVdfHJcnJb9ruWC/4LG1Tz4lB8DctXhemPKukW Phk12EMvODlJ+PanzHqzAJN6+TpsNjJS4biTkF3FVzwW80fXi9upsrfvFaWx3DgjxCG8 0j355s6cte5s7gEwQVmcy/MT8mWF6C6e6eFq8dWGAdWr6JKCOR/NtPIQtNxvmoXHmfey J/kesBJYCIExQ8w/LwVz7bzbst+ndlqUWtZqid+SSWOfo2pK38YaspU+C08uL2nJcGCz Ri7w== X-Gm-Message-State: ALoCoQkp3mOROI3IbdyEIAN3tsjhX+XorYkyzSkaZN/t9QotadE0nOrz1aBZO7x4ZieqNIV62bZE X-Received: by 10.107.169.216 with SMTP id f85mr45406715ioj.73.1441773732349; Tue, 08 Sep 2015 21:42:12 -0700 (PDT) Received: from kaki.bld.corp.google.com ([172.29.216.32]) by smtp.gmail.com with ESMTPSA id kb10sm919428igb.4.2015.09.08.21.42.09 (version=TLSv1.2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Tue, 08 Sep 2015 21:42:10 -0700 (PDT) Received: by kaki.bld.corp.google.com (Postfix, from userid 121222) id 970D82219C1; Tue, 8 Sep 2015 22:33:20 -0600 (MDT) From: Simon Glass To: U-Boot Mailing List Date: Tue, 8 Sep 2015 22:32:46 -0600 Message-Id: <1441773171-4575-24-git-send-email-sjg@chromium.org> X-Mailer: git-send-email 2.6.0.rc0.131.gf624c3d In-Reply-To: <1441773171-4575-1-git-send-email-sjg@chromium.org> References: <1441773171-4575-1-git-send-email-sjg@chromium.org> Cc: Masahiro Yamada , Tom Rini Subject: [U-Boot] [PATCH 23/28] input: Add a Kconfig option for the i8042 keyboard X-BeenThere: u-boot@lists.denx.de X-Mailman-Version: 2.1.15 Precedence: list List-Id: U-Boot disc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, MIME-Version: 1.0 Errors-To: u-boot-bounces@lists.denx.de Sender: "U-Boot" Add a new option CONFIG_I8042_KEYB which will replace the current CONFIG_I8042_KBD. This new name fits better with existing drivers. Signed-off-by: Simon Glass Reviewed-by: Bin Meng --- drivers/input/Kconfig |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/drivers/input/Kconfig b/drivers/input/Kconfig index 447c4c3..d560328 100644 --- a/drivers/input/Kconfig +++ b/drivers/input/Kconfig @@ -13,3 +13,13 @@ config CROS_EC_KEYB Most ARM Chromebooks use an EC to provide access to the keyboard. Messages are used to request key scans from the EC and these are then decoded into keys by this driver. + +config I8042_KEYB + bool "Enable Intel i8042 keyboard support" + depends on DM_KEYBOARD + help + This adds a driver for the i8042 keyboard controller, allowing the + keyboard to be used on devices which support this controller. The + driver handles English and German keyboards - set the environment + variable 'keymap' to "de" to select German. Keyboard repeat is + handled by the keyboard itself.